STOVER v. ALABAMA FARM BUREAU INS. CO.

83-1303.

467 So.2d 251 (1985)

Richard STOVER v. ALABAMA FARM BUREAU INSURANCE CO.

Supreme Court of Alabama.

March 22, 1985.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John L. Sims, Hartselle, for appellant.

Gordon T. Carter, Montgomery, Norman W. Harris, Decatur, for appellee.


TORBERT, Chief Justice.

Richard Stover, plaintiff, appeals from a summary judgment in favor of the defendant, Alabama Farm Bureau, in Stover's suit for breach of an employment contract. The issue on appeal as stated by Stover is:
